Registered Nurse - Operating Room

Description Location: UCHealth Cherry Creek Med Ctr, Denver, CO Department: Cook St OR All Spec Activity Work Schedule: Full Time, 80.00 hours per pay period (2 weeks) Shift: Days Pay: $37.06 - $57.44 / hour. Pay is dependent on applicant's relevant experience This position is an onsite role and does not offer a hybrid or remote option Summary: Provides direct patient care in a surgical setting at a proficient level, in accordance with applicable scope and standards of practice with the policies, values, and mission of the organization. Monitors and manages the patient and operative environment before, during and after surgery to maintain a safe environment, optimize outcomes and maximize available resources. Responsibilities: Performs circulating functions before surgery, including preparing the operating environment, orienting and assessing the patient, and reviewing patient's medical record and surgeon's notes to ensure all pre-requisites and preferences are met. Ensures safety checklists and procedures are implemented and documented at all times. Performs circulating functions during surgery, including monitoring and communicating patient condition, documenting interventions and activities, monitoring the sterile field and controlling traffic into, out of and around the room. Performs scrub functions, including the preparation, selection, and handling of instruments and supplies used during the surgical procedure and performs surgical counts with the circulating nurse. Provides nursing care to a complex, high acuity surgical patient population in a technically complex environment. Within scope of job, requires critical thinking skills, decisive judgement and the ability to work with minimal supervision. Must be able to work in a fast-paced environment and take appropriate action.
